So, upon purchase it worked like a dream. Epic render distance and low everything else worked at 60 fps on Fortnite. Took 5 minutes to set up. But one thing was wrong. We noticed that the backlit keyboard was missing. After searching we found out that it no longer comes with a backlit keyboard.
Works well for office or general use but there are a couple of issues: -It doesn't sleep properly. Often it was on after sleep was selected -There isn't really any way to fix screen bleed -It doesn't explain when the graphics card kicks in (or if it is on all the time it is a battery waste)
